Datasheet

2016-2017 Microchip Technology Inc. DS00002112B-page 21
KSZ8795CLX
The KSZ8795CLX will not forward the following packets:
Error packets. These include framing errors, frame check sequence (FCS) errors, alignment errors, and illegal
size packet errors.
IEEE802.3x PAUSE frames. KSZ8795CLX intercepts these packets and performs full duplex flow control accord-
ingly.
"Local" packets. Based on destination address (DA) lookup, if the destination port from the lookup table matches
the port from which the packet originated, the packet is defined as "local."
3.3.6 SWITCHING ENGINE
The KSZ8795CLX features a high-performance switching engine to move data to and from the MAC’s packet buffers.
It operates in store and forward mode, while the efficient switching mechanism reduces overall latency. The KSZ8795-
CLX has a 64 kB internal frame buffer. This resource is shared between all five ports. There are a total of 512 buffers
available. Each buffer is sized at 128 bytes.
3.4 Power and Power Management
The KSZ8795CLX device requires 3.3V analog power. An external 1.2V LDO provides the necessary 1.2V to power the
analog and digital logic cores. The various I/Os can be operated at 1.8V, 2.5V, and 3.3V. Ta bl e 3- 2 illustrates the various
voltage options and requirements of the device.
FIGURE 3-4: DESTINATION ADDRESS LOOKUP AND RESOLUTION FLOW CHART
TABLE 3-2: KSZ8795CLX VOLTAGE OPTIONS AND REQUIREMENTS
Power Signal
Name
Device Pin Requirement
VDDAT 2, 12, 76 3.3V or 2.5V input power to the analog blocks of transceiver in the
device.
VDDIO 34, 48, 70 Choice of 1.8V or 2.5V or 3.3V for the I/O circuits. These input power
pins power the I/O circuitry of the device.
START
NO
- SEARCH VLAN TABLE
- INGRESS VLAN FILTERING
- DISCARD NPVID CHECK
- SEARCH BASED ON
DA OR DA + FID
- SEARCH BASED ON
DA + FID
YES
FOUND
NOT FOUND
- CHECK RECEIVING PORT’S RECEIVE ENABLE BIT
- CHECK DESTINATION PORT’S TRANSMIT ENABLE BIT
- CHECK WHETHER PACKETS ARE SPECIAL (BPDU)
- APPLIED TO MAC (#1 TO #4)
- MAC #5 IS RESERVED FOR µC
- IGMP WILL BE FORWARDED TO PORT 5
- RX MIRROR
- TX MIRROR
- RX OR TX MIRROR
- RX AND TX MIRROR
PTF 1
SPANNING
TREE
PROCESS
IGMP
PROCESS
PORT
MIRROR
PROCESS
PORT VLAN
MEMBERSHIP
CHECK
PTF 2
VLAN ID
VALID?
SEARCH
STATIC
ARRAY
SEARCH
ADDRESS
LOOK-UP
TABLE
PTF 2
GET PTF 1
FROM ADDRESS
TABLE
GET PTF 1 FROM
VLAN TABLE
GET PTF 1
FROM STATIC
ARRAY
PTF 1 = NULL
NOT FOUND
FOUND
PORT
AUTHENTICATION
AND ACL